Territory, Identity and Spatial Planning: Spatial Governance in a Fragmented Nation Book

Provides a multi-disciplinary study of territory identity and space in a devolved UK through the lens of spatial planning. This book draws together internationally renowned researchers from a variety of disciplines to address the implications of devolution upon spatial planning and the rescaling of UK politics.Read More
